What is Symcon?
Founded in 1990 and based in Charlotte, North Carolina, Symcon operates as a comprehensive global provider of essential consumables, raw materials, and specialized parts. The company's offerings are critical for industries that rely on sophisticated manufacturing processes such as vacuum deposition, thin-film technology, surfacing, injection molding, and various coating applications. Symcon's long-standing presence and broad industry reach highlight its role as a key enabler of complex production environments.
